Here, we demonstrate space division multiplexed phase compensation in the osaka metropolitan networks. our compensation scheme uses two neighboring fibers, one for quantum communication and the other for sensing and compensating the phase drift. Ensation of quantum communication usually monitors the phase drift by a reference laser. many studies have exclusively employed a time division multiplexed phase compensation, which is based on the temporal separation.
